Job Description

A government entity in Manitoba seeks an IMS Inspector - Mechanical to ensure compliance with safety standards related to boilers. Candidates must have a 3rd Class Power Engineer certification or a Mechanical Engineering degree. Key competencies include strong communication skills and proficiency in Microsoft Office applications. The role requires independence, decision-making skills, and the ability to work under pressure. Experience in boiler inspections is essential. Full-time position with salary range of CAD 74,504 to 97,294 per year.
